Originally Posted by AriS4
Still using this surge tank ? Any thoughts on the newer designs by Radium ? which can accommodate more pumps ? A bit larger tank on those ? Also I think they are modified but - are you running the stock rails ? If yes what are the mods on them ? THX .. in advance
No I am no longer using this setup. I made 900whp on e85 on it but it was running out of fuel. In addition to what's posted here I was using an E85 Walbro 450 in place of the stock pump.

I am still convinced this setup would support 1000whp on C16. About 775whp safely on E85.

I now use custom rails that Tim made for me, 2x 1800hp FueLab pumps, no surge tank, electronic fuel pressure regulator that ramps up the pumps.
